Few can match John Morales contribution to the world of the enthusiast turned remixer come producer. John Morales is considered one of true legends of the mix. And his work some thirty years later continues to be cutting wedge and inspiring. Although familiar with John's work - his epic mix of Universal Robot Band's boogie anthem is the source from which BBE Records got its name - No attempt had been made to summarise the pinnacle of John's work. This second release is continued history lesson in dance music. He formed with the late Sergio Munzibai, M+M productions whose output of over 650 mixes will be unmatched by many celebrity big name remixers of today. From the Rolling Stones to Gloria Estefan, The Temptations to Hall and Oates, Aretha Franklin to BBE - we have all been moulded by Johns everlasting influence. This superb double CD presents some of John's finest works. One CD of classic boogie, cult favourites featuring John's first credited mix of Inner Life's Caught Up In A One Night Love Affair whilst CD two showcases for the first time previously unreleased mixes of gems from the legendary Salsoul catalogue from anthems like My Love is Free to the underground Cult hit Jocelyn Brown's Make It Last Forever. This is the legacy of the M+M mixes.
